gpt4 book ai didi

haskell - 如何解决 cabal 存储库中不再存在的旧软件包?

转载 作者:行者123 更新时间:2023-12-02 10:35:59 25 4
gpt4 key购买 nike

例如,我想构建 snap-pastie项目。但所需的包 snap-extension-mongodb 在 cabal 存储库中不可用。

对于 snap-extension-* 包也是如此。

最佳答案

你必须download and install the package yourself (从 gi​​t checkout 目录中进行cabal install 应该可以做到)。

但是,该代码根本无法保证正常工作;当该存储库上次提交时,Snap 位于 version 0.4.2 ;现在是 0.7 。您可能必须安装所有 Snap 软件包的旧版本 (cabal install foo==version),或者更好的是,尝试将代码移植到最新版本。

顺便说一句,我认为 Hackage 上从来没有这个包;已弃用的软件包可以根据请求从主列表中隐藏,但我认为它们不会被完全删除,并且 the package page是 404。

snaplet-mongoDB如果您决定将代码移植到最新的 Snap,可能会有所帮助,尽管它现在似乎还没有构建;您必须联系作者。

关于haskell - 如何解决 cabal 存储库中不再存在的旧软件包?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8634832/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com